Retirement Systems of Alabama »

Msa Safety Inc equity shares owned by Retirement Systems of Alabama

Quarter-by-quarter ownership of Msa Safety Inc equity (MSA) shares owned by Retirement Systems of Alabama from 13F filings

Historical chart of Retirement Systems of Alabama investment in Msa Safety Inc equity

Tip: Access up to 7 years of quarterly data

All positions including Msa Safety Inc equity held by Retirement Systems of Alabama consolidated in one spreadsheet with up to 7 years of data

Download as csvDownload consolidated filings csv Download as ExcelDownload consolidated filings xlsx

Quarterly reported holdings in Msa Safety Inc equity by Retirement Systems of Alabama

Quarter filed Position value Share count Share price at filing
2024-03-31 $18M 95k 193.59
2023-12-31 $7.8M 46k 168.83
2023-09-30 $7.3M 46k 157.65
2023-06-30 $8.3M 48k 173.96
2023-03-31 $6.4M 48k 133.50
2022-12-31 $7.0M 49k 144.19
2022-09-30 $5.3M 48k 109.28
2022-06-30 $5.8M 48k 121.06
2022-03-31 $6.3M 48k 132.70
2021-12-31 $15M 98k 150.96
2021-09-30 $14M 98k 145.70
2021-06-30 $16M 98k 165.58
2021-03-31 $14M 96k 150.03
2020-12-31 $14M 92k 149.39
2020-09-30 $13M 93k 134.17
2020-06-30 $11M 94k 114.44
2020-03-31 $10M 101k 101.20
2019-12-31 $13M 105k 126.36
2019-09-30 $12M 107k 109.11
2019-06-30 $9.9M 94k 105.39
2019-03-31 $9.7M 94k 103.40
2018-12-31 $4.3M 45k 94.27
2018-09-30 $4.8M 45k 106.45
2018-06-30 $4.3M 44k 96.34
2018-03-31 $3.7M 44k 83.25
2017-12-31 $3.4M 44k 77.52
2017-09-30 $3.5M 44k 79.52
2017-06-30 $3.3M 41k 81.16
2017-03-31 $2.9M 41k 70.69
2016-12-31 $2.8M 40k 69.32
2016-09-30 $2.3M 40k 58.03
2016-06-30 $2.2M 41k 52.53
2016-03-31 $2.0M 41k 48.34
2015-12-31 $1.8M 41k 43.47
2015-09-30 $1.6M 40k 39.96
2015-06-30 $1.9M 40k 48.50
2015-03-31 $2.0M 40k 49.87
2014-12-31 $2.1M 40k 53.10
2014-09-30 $2.0M 40k 49.41
2014-06-30 $2.2M 39k 57.47
2014-03-31 $2.2M 39k 56.99